1 Corinthians 16:19 - Revised Version with Apocrypha 1895 The churches of Asia salute you. Aquila and Prisca salute you much in the Lord, with the church that is in their house. More versionsKing James Version (Oxford) 1769 The churches of Asia salute you. Aquila and Priscilla salute you much in the Lord, with the church that is in their house. Amplified Bible - Classic Edition The churches of Asia send greetings and best wishes. Aquila and Prisca, together with the church [that meets] in their house, send you their hearty greetings in the Lord. American Standard Version (1901) The churches of Asia salute you. Aquila and Prisca salute you much in the Lord, with the church that is in their house. Common English Bible The churches in the province of Asia greet you. Aquila and Prisca greet you warmly in the Lord, together with the church that meets in their house. Catholic Public Domain Version The churches of Asia greet you. Aquila and Priscilla greet you greatly in the Lord, with the church of their household, where I also am a guest. Douay-Rheims version of The Bible - 1752 version The churches of Asia salute you. Aquila and Priscilla salute you much in the Lord, with the church that is in their house, with whom I also lodge. |
